I've never gotten into shaping my own grips due to the amount I've screwed up trying. If you were going to buy preformed grips for flocking, which ones would you buy?

You won't need the absolute best quality because you're covering the cork. So back down a grade or two and enjoy the savings. Two places I would definitely inquire would be Neal's Fishing Products and Lamar Manufacturing. I'm sure plenty of other sponsors also have what you're looking for, but those two just come to mind quickly.
